An industrial supplier has shipped a truckload of teflon lubricant cartridges to an aerospace customer. The customer has been assured tha the mean weight of these cartridges is less than the 10 ounces printed on each cartridge. To check this claim, a sample of n=10 cartridges is randomly selected from the shipment and weighed. Summary statistics for the sample are: x = 9.95 ounces, s = .30 ounce. To determine whether the supplier's claim is true, consider the test, Ho:u = 10 vs Ha: u < 10, where u is the true mean weight of the cartridges. Use a=.01. Find the test statistic for this test O A. z=.61 O B. z=-61 O C. t=-53 O D. t=.53
